Bangladesh ex-PM Khaleda Zia freed after arch-rival Sheikh Hasina toppled amid unrest – Times of India

Khaleda Zia, former Bangladesh prime minister and a prominent opposition figure, has been released from years of house arrest after the ousting of her political rival, Sheikh Hasina. Bangladesh Air Force’s flight ‘AJAX1431’ likely carrying former Bangladesh PM Sheikh Hasina among the ‘most-tracked’ flights – Times of India

Bangladesh Air Force’s flight AJAX1431 became the most tracked flight, according to the online tracker, Flightradar24.com. Believed to be carrying Bangladesh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ina, the flight was being tracked by over 29,000 users.
